Output 9420096bc0133c5d10445492116da0eae752901e993958c32aba94a38590842b:1

value
2311082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61ea50cca822f613aa7401ccf43ea91fd1aff775 OP_EQUAL
address
3AckAgkcTrYPfXnbmm5sT8BcMk5Rrj6wkt
transaction
9420096bc0133c5d10445492116da0eae752901e993958c32aba94a38590842b
confirmations
364782
spent
true